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ton

About

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ton ward is located in the Ribble Valley, Lancashire. The area is known for its rural landscape, with rolling farmland and wooded valleys. The River Ribble flows nearby, shaping the natural scenery. The ward includes the villages of Waddington, Bashall Eaves, and Great Mitton, each with historic buildings and traditional stone cottages.

The ward has a mix of agricultural land and small settlements, with a focus on farming and local businesses. Walking routes like the Ribble Way attract visitors, while the area remains quiet and residential. The historic St Helen's Church in Great Mitton dates back to the 13th century. Community events and village pubs contribute to local life, maintaining a close-knit feel.

Area overview

On average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ton has moderate deprivation and moderate crime levels, with around 60 crimes per 1,000 residents per year. Approximately 5.0%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income of residents in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ton is £48,235 per year. There are 1 schools in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ton: 1 primary (0 Outstanding and 1 Good) and 0 secondary (0 Outstanding and 0 Good).

Property prices in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ton

Based on 14 recent sales, the median property price is £323,300 in Waddington, Bashall Eaves & Mitton area, with individual transactions ranging from £230,000 up to £760,000.
By property type: detached homes sit at £695,000; semi-detached at £253,500; terraced at £293,250;.
